Abstract: CONTENT: Didactic lecture is the most common teaching–learning method with minimum analytical and evaluative power. Multiple-choice questions (MCQs) can be used as a check on learning, break monotony, and detect gaps in understanding. AIMS: The aim of this study was to assess the cognitive domain by evaluating pre- and postlecture MCQ scores among 2 nd -year undergraduate medical students. SETTINGS AND DESIGN: This cross-sectional study was done in Goa Medical College. SUBJECTS AND METHODS: One hundred and fifty 2 nd -year undergraduate medical students were randomly selected based on computer computer-generated random number without replacement on a Microsoft Excel sheet. Pretest was administered to the students on a topic in pharmacology followed by a lecture on the same topic. Posttest was given at the end of the lecture. Scores of pre- and postlecture MCQs were tabulated. STATISTICAL ANALYSIS: Data was entered in a Microsoft Excel sheet and analyzed using a student paired t -test. The results were expressed in tables and a chart. RESULTS: A total of 150 students participated in the pre- and posttest, of which 84 were female and 66 were male. The mean and standard deviation were compared for pre- and posttest. Marks obtained were calculated and tabulated as mean scores which showed a highly significant improvement in the posttest where majority of the students scored better as compared to pretest. The results were compared using a paired t -test which was highly significant ( P < 0.001). CONCLUSIONS: Lecture followed by MCQs is an effective teaching–learning method which significantly enhanced students’ cognition.
